Alarm system  

Alarm System

-----

An alarm system in a labeling machine notifies operators of errors or malfunctions, such as label jams, misfeeds, or low supply. It ensures timely intervention, reduces downtime, and maintains consistent production quality, enhancing efficiency and reliability across food, beverage, chemical, and cosmetic labeling lines.

Bottle Straightening Mechanism

-----

The bottle straightening mechanism in a labeling machine ensures round bottles are properly aligned before labeling. By adjusting and stabilizing bottles on the conveyor, it prevents misalignment and label wrinkles, improving accuracy, consistency, and overall efficiency in high-speed production lines.

Conveyor chain plate  

Conveyor Chain Plate

-----

The conveyor chain plate in a labeling machine provides stable and precise transportation of bottles or containers through the labeling process. It ensures smooth movement, maintains correct bottle spacing, and supports high-speed operation, improving labeling accuracy, reducing jams, and enhancing overall production efficiency.

Label Collection Mechanism

-----

The label collection mechanism in a labeling machine gathers waste backing paper or unused labels during the labeling process. It ensures clean operation, prevents jams, and maintains production efficiency. By keeping the workspace organized, it supports smooth, continuous labeling and enhances overall machine reliability.

Label roller device  

Label Roller Device

-----

The label roller device in a labeling machine ensures smooth and precise application of labels onto bottles or containers. It maintains consistent pressure and alignment, prevents wrinkles or misplacement, and supports high-speed operation, enhancing labeling accuracy, efficiency, and overall production quality.

Label Rolling Power Mechanism

-----

The label rolling power mechanism in a labeling machine drives and controls the rotation of labels for precise application on bottles or containers. It ensures consistent tension, smooth feeding, and accurate placement, reducing label wrinkles and misalignment while improving efficiency and maintaining high-quality production.

Photoelectric detection  

Photoelectric Detection

-----

Photoelectric detection in a labeling machine uses sensors to detect bottle positions and label presence, ensuring precise alignment and timing. It prevents mislabeling, reduces waste, and enables high-speed, accurate operation, improving overall efficiency, consistency, and reliability in industrial labeling processes.

Voltage specifications

AC220V   50/60HZ

Power consumption

980W

Labeling speed

40-200 bottles/minute (speed adjustable, depending on object size and label length)

Labeling accuracy

+1mm (depending on product characteristics, softness, hardness, and roundness)

Bottle diameter

25-120mm

Object Range

Height 20mm~~300mm (can be customized according to customer requirements)

Label specifications

Height 10mm~~150mm, length 15~~300mm (special specifications can be customized)

Inner diameter of paper roll

Φ 76mm paper roll outer diameter: Φ 300 (maximum)

Weight

200KG

Packaging size

1950X1100X1300mm

Belt width

Customized according to the diameter of the sample bottle provided by the customer
